Transaction 4c56950c2c075c56ec4a62c33201ad126961d29f3750606c2664e645dfb7cb63

2 Input
2 Outputs
  • 4c56950c2c075c56ec4a62c33201ad126961d29f3750606c2664e645dfb7cb63:0
  • value  23917483441
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 4c56950c2c075c56ec4a62c33201ad126961d29f3750606c2664e645dfb7cb63:1
  • value  5282054109
    address  3LKaN85fUCmutBYamoK2EcPHMqDPnDJXya